Calligraphic Ofbu 4 is a very light, normal width, low cont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A lightly drawn, handwritten alphabet with smooth, rounded construction and predominantly monoline strokes. Curves are generous and open, with soft, tapered terminals that feel pen-made rather than geometric. Proportions are slightly irregular from glyph to glyph, giving a natural rhythm; bowls and loops (notably in O/Q, g, e) are roomy while straight strokes stay slender. Capitals are simple and clean with modest flare and occasional gentle asymmetry, while lowercase forms remain compact with short ascenders/descenders and a relaxed baseline flow.
Works well for invitations, greeting cards, and short editorial pull quotes where a gentle handwritten voice is desired. It also suits boutique packaging and small-brand headings that benefit from a light, personal touch, and performs best when given enough size and white space.
The overall tone is calm and personable, with a subtle sense of elegance. Its thin, airy strokes and rounded forms read as friendly and approachable, while the restrained calligraphic touches add a lightly refined, boutique feel.
The design appears intended to provide a clean, legible handwritten look that stays polished rather than messy, combining simple letterforms with subtle pen-like terminals. It aims for an informal-yet-neat personality suitable for refined personal communication and tasteful display typography.
Spacing appears comfortably open in text, helping the thin strokes stay readable at larger sizes. Numerals follow the same light, hand-drawn logic, with smooth curves and minimal ornament, keeping the set cohesive for casual display and short runs of information.
